Fill up your cup, sit down, and lay back with this classy and intelligent podcast. Featuring open-minded, imaginative, and curious conversations inspired by individual perspectives, A Cup of Tea will leave you with both a feeling of relaxation and a sense of enlightenment at the end of each episode.
